C O N F I D E N T I A L VILNIUS 000175 SIPDIS STATE FOR EUR/NB AND EUR/UMB E.O. 12958: DECL: 02/23/2014 TAGS: PREL, PGOV, LH, HT7 SUBJECT: LITHUANIA TO HOST MARCH EU MEETING ON BELARUS Classified By: POL/ECON OFFICER TREVOR BOYD FOR REASONS 1.4 (B) AND (D) 1. (U) Mindaugas Kacerauskas, head of MFA's Belarus, Ukraine and Moldova Division told us February 22 that Lithuania will host the March 17-18 EU Commission meeting on Belarus. The event sponsors, Lithuania's MFA and the EU Commission's Directorate of External Relations, plan to bring together governmental and non-governmental representatives from the EU, Canada, and the United States to discuss developing democracy and coordinating assistance in Belarus. 2. (C) Comment: MFA officials criticize what they characterize as the EU's preference for humanitarian and social assistance projects. Lithuania will use the meeting to focus international efforts on its preferred path to change in Belarus -- the unabashed promotion of democracy. Mull
